Improving the Reliability and Meeting Growing Needs in Culpeper County

The Culpeper Tech Zone 230 kV Electric Transmission Project will support data center load growth and area reliability in the Culpeper, Orange, and Fauquier County areas.

Project Details

This project includes four components:

  • Building four new substations within the Culpeper Tech Zone and a 230 kV transmission line to connect them to the electrical grid in the Town of Culpeper and Culpeper County.
  • Upgrading 0.7 miles of existing 115 kV transmission line in Faquier County to 240 kV.
  • Upgrading 2.7 miles of existing 115 kV transmission line in Culpeper and Orange Counties to 230 kV.
  • Upgrading and relocating the exiting Oak Green Substation to a parcel nearby its existing location.

On February 20, 2025, Dominion Energy filed an application to construct this project with the Virginia State Corporation Commission (SCC). The SCC issued its' Final Order approving the project on March 12, 2026. Please see the Legal tab for the final approval document and additional details.
